Output f066fa3a132ff5ec69bfcd06f1bd3cb773e68c8ac15690fa5da125cd9f6305ff:0

value
8633990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d38d0d9c766691c2964a6114d2426bb4a4d179c9 OP_EQUAL
address
3LybUZn6kiKK41TvRqsQx21Rap2c6fqXys
transaction
f066fa3a132ff5ec69bfcd06f1bd3cb773e68c8ac15690fa5da125cd9f6305ff
confirmations
313184
spent
true